导入到SQLite数据库是指将数据从外部文件或其他数据库系统中导入到SQLite数据库中。SQLite是一种轻量级的嵌入式数据库引擎,它不需要独立的服务器进程,可以直接嵌入到应用程序中,因此非常适合移动应用和嵌入式设备。
SQLite数据库的导入可以通过以下几种方式进行:
- 使用命令行工具导入:SQLite提供了命令行工具sqlite3,可以使用该工具执行导入操作。首先,需要创建一个目标数据库,并在命令行中进入sqlite3交互模式。然后,使用SQLite的导入命令将数据从外部文件导入到数据库中。例如,可以使用如下命令导入一个以逗号分隔的文本文件:.separator ,
.import data.csv table_name其中,data.csv是包含数据的文件名,table_name是要导入的目标表名。
- 使用编程语言的SQLite库导入:可以使用支持SQLite的编程语言(如Python、Java、C++等)中的SQLite库来导入数据。首先,需要连接到SQLite数据库,并打开一个游标。然后,使用相应的库函数或方法执行导入操作。具体的导入方式和代码示例会因编程语言而异。
SQLite数据库的导入可以应用于多种场景,例如:
- 数据迁移:将数据从其他数据库系统(如MySQL、Oracle等)迁移到SQLite数据库中,以便在嵌入式设备或移动应用中使用。
- 数据备份和恢复:将数据导出到外部文件,以便在需要时进行备份和恢复操作。
- 数据集成:将来自不同数据源的数据导入到SQLite数据库中,以便进行数据分析和查询操作。
腾讯云提供了云数据库SQL for SQLite服务,可以在云端快速创建和管理SQLite数据库实例。您可以通过腾讯云控制台或API进行数据库的导入操作。具体的产品介绍和使用方法,请参考腾讯云官方文档:云数据库SQL for SQLite。